Features:
- 14 independently isolated analog output channels
- Native support for 4 to 20 mA current loops and 1 to 5 VDC voltage ranges
- Features built-in channel-to-channel galvanic isolation to protect internal rack logic lines against field side voltage surges or ground loop interference
The ABB SPASO11 is a high-performance, high-density isolated analog output (AO) module designed by ABB specifically for Symphony Plus (S+ HR) and Harmony rack control systems. Equipped with 14 high-density analog output channels, this module primarily serves as a critical interface between distributed control systems (DCS) and industrial field devices. It outputs high-precision analog control signals, enabling continuous and precise regulation and control of field devices such as actuators, control valves, regulators, and drives.
The SPASO11 offers excellent industry-standard compatibility in terms of functional adaptability and system integration. It fully supports standard 4-20 mA current signals and 1-5 V voltage signals at the channel level, allowing users to flexibly configure these signals in the system software according to the needs of different actuators. Furthermore, the module features robust channel electrical isolation and comprehensive intelligent diagnostic mechanisms, including hardware-level reverse polarity protection and output short-circuit protection. This effectively prevents electromagnetic interference or surges on the field side from affecting the internal logic network, thereby ensuring long-term stability and high availability of system control in complex process automation environments.

The working principle of this model is as follows: the module receives digital control commands and process preset values from the main controller in real time via the I/O expansion bus of the control rack. The microprocessor inside the module decodes and performs logic verification on these digital signals, and then sends them to the onboard multi-channel digital-to-analog converter (DAC) to accurately convert the digital logic signals into proportional weak voltage signals. Finally, through the internal signal conditioning and power drive circuit (including V/I converter), the signal is modulated into a standard 4-20 mA current or 1-5 V voltage signal, and output to the external actuator through the field terminal unit, thereby driving the opening or speed of the field equipment to achieve closed-loop control.
SPASO11 is widely used in continuous production industries where even a one-minute unexpected downtime can result in losses of thousands of dollars:
Coal Power Plants: Heavy-duty regulating control valves controlling main steam conditioning, boiler feed pumps, cooling water flow, and fuel supply actuators.
Water and Wastewater Treatment: Managing proportioning metering pumps for chemical injection, regulating electric gate valves, and controlling the speed of large aeration blowers.
Chemical and Petrochemical Industries: Regulating feed valves, controlling distillation column reflux valves, and maintaining pressure in critical storage tanks.
Pulp and Paper Mills: Regulating feed flow valves, steam dryer pressure, and continuous chemical bleaching feed.
